
Current Board of Directors
[*The UrbanArt Commission is an independent 501(c)3 non-profit organization. It's Board of Directors sets its operating policies, organization by-laws, guides private fundraising efforts, and determines its organizational budget.]

Current Public Art Oversight Committee Members
[*The Public Art Oversight Committee (PAOC) is a supervisory group mandated by the City of Memphis responsible for approving all City of Memphis 'Percent for Art' projects. The PAOC reviews City of Memphis projects only, and not any of the other UrbanArt projects affiliated with Memphis City Schools, the Memphis Area Transit Authority, nor projects commissioned from private developers, patrons, or community groups.]
